Located in New South Wales within the Gilgandra local government area, Biddon is a quiet locality (postcode 2827). The area has roughly 123 residents and an established family demographic, with a median age of 38. Households earn a median income of $68K per year, with an average household size of 2.5 people. The most common occupations are managers, clerical & administrative, professionals. Employment in the area leans toward agriculture and professional services. The top ancestries reported are Australian, English, Scottish.
The current median weekly rent is $300. The median monthly mortgage repayment is $759.
Public transport access includes 9 bus stops. The crime rate in the Gilgandra LGA is moderate at 5,877 incidents per 100,000 population.
